摘要
This study reports the synthesis, characterization, and biological evaluation of a series of pyrazolyl-thiazole derivatives of thiophene. Seven compounds were synthesized and characterized using NMR spectroscopy and mass spectrometry. The antimicrobial activities of these derivatives were evaluated against various bacterial (Escherichia coli, Bacillus subtilis, Bacillus megaterium, Staphylococcus aureus) and fungal strains (Aspergillus niger, Aspergillus oryzae, Rhizopus, Candida albicans), demonstrating significant inhibition zones and low minimum inhibitory concentrations (MIC). In addition, the compounds exhibited notable antioxidant activities in DPPH and hydroxyl radical scavenging assays. Computational studies, including density functional theory (DFT) calculations and molecular docking simulations, were performed to understand the electronic properties and binding interactions of the synthesized compounds with biological targets. The molecular docking results supported the experimental findings, highlighting the potential of these pyrazolyl-thiazole derivatives as multifunctional therapeutic agents with both antimicrobial and antioxidant properties.
